Galaxy S10 SeriesI have discovered that the Verizon text app gives no notification (vibrate nor audible). But the Samsung app does give vibration but no audible when bluetooth headset is being used. Audible comes through the headset. When I turn headset off, Samsung's app works fine. The software added toggles to the headset which I think screwed it up.

Galaxy S10 SeriesFigured my issue out, I long pressed on each contacts set of messages and pressed notifications. It was bugging the hell out of me.
